Three fire hoses are connected to a fire hydrant. Each hose has a radius of 0.013 m. Water enters the hydrant through an underground pipe of radius 0.094 m. In this pipe the water has a speed of 3.2 m/s.
(a) How many kilograms of water are poured onto a fire in one hour by all three hoses?
(b) Find the water speed in each hose.
